Overview
What Service Contract & Client Workflow Bundle Builder does.
This skill takes a single runtime input — the service niche you name — and produces a coordinated, ready-to-spec template bundle covering every client-facing document that business type needs. It outputs a full document list (service contract, project timeline, onboarding questionnaire, pre- and post-project checklists, delivery confirmation, and review request), a brand style guide, cover and mockup concept notes, an Etsy-optimized title and description, 13 keyword tags, paste-ready Canva image-generation prompts, and a final export checklist. Everything is matched and named as a coherent product, not a pile of loose files.
A buyer selling Etsy digital products types in something like 'virtual assistant client onboarding bundle' and receives a fully labeled spec: document titles and page counts, a layout and color palette plan keyed to the niche, an SEO title structured to match Etsy search intent, all 13 tags, and image prompt copy they can paste directly into Canva or an AI image tool. The output is a build brief, not raw content — it tells you exactly what to create and how to present it, so no session starts from a blank page.
Sample output excerpt for a dog training business niche — Document list: 1) Client Service Agreement (3 pp), 2) Training Session Timeline Template (1 p), 3) Dog Intake Questionnaire (2 pp), 4) Pre-Session Prep Checklist (1 p), 5) Post-Session Progress Note (1 p), 6) Package Delivery Confirmation (1 p), 7) Review Request Card (1 p). Style guide: warm earth tones, sans-serif body, illustrated paw-print accent. SEO title: 'Dog Training Client Contract Bundle — 7 Editable Canva Templates, Coach Onboarding Forms.' Tags include: dog trainer contract, pet business forms, canine coach templates (plus 10 more).

FAQ
Common questions.
What do I actually type in as the input?
Just the niche or product concept — for example, 'wedding photographer client workflow bundle' or 'life coach onboarding templates.' The more specific you are, the more tightly matched the document list and SEO output will be, but even a broad niche like 'cleaning business' produces a usable result.
Does this skill write the actual contract or template text, or does it spec out what to create?
It produces a detailed build specification: document titles, page counts, layout and design direction, and SEO copy. It does not draft the full legal contract language or fill in every template field — you use the spec to build the files in Canva, Google Docs, or a similar tool.
Can the same skill be run for different niches, or is it locked to one?
The niche is a runtime input, so you can run it as many times as you like for different service types. Each run produces a distinct document list and SEO set tailored to that specific business category.
What format does the output arrive in?
The skill returns structured text organized into labeled sections: the document spec list, style guide notes, SEO title and description, 13 tags, image prompts, and an export checklist. You copy and use each section in whichever tool it applies to — Etsy listing editor, Canva, your file manager.
Is this suited to niches outside photography and design, or was it built with those in mind?
It was built to adapt to any service business — the documented examples include coaches, cleaners, consultants, tutors, and planners, among others. The document types it generates (contract, intake questionnaire, checklist, review request) apply broadly; the naming, tone guidance, and tags shift to match whatever niche you supply.
